Collards BB, Durban

Durban, 4051 ,South Africa
Collards BB, Durban Collards BB, Durban is one of the popular Hotel located in ,Durban listed under Local business in Durban , Hotel in Durban ,

Contact Details & Working Hours

Map of Collards BB, Durban